The lengthy, somewhat pointed head gives the fish an appearance similar to that of a … Web12 Mar 2024 · Head shape: Rattlesnakes have the classic pit viper triangular head. Bull snakes have pointed snouts that allow them to dig more easily, giving their head a more triangular appearance–though not as noticeable as a rattlesnake’s head. Size: Bull snakes and rattlesnakes are similar in size and build–both snakes have thick, strong bodies ...

Web20 Jun 2024 · Coral snakes have slender heads, round eyes, and no sensing pits. They are easily confused with a number of other fake-looking snakes including the scarlet king snakes and milk snakes, but can be distinguished in two ways. First, there’s a cute little rhyme that goes “Red against yellow: kills a fellow. Red against black: safe for Jack.”
